Output 15ea1d5e75c4e54c73ac863dad295161fad2c1102d0d4f6aa19cb1c5ce862579:45

value
62250620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b63a5482fd3e51e814b392bf946978692bcb3a8 OP_EQUALVERIFY OP_CHECKSIG
address
1NTdAaeR96ayCvASgga2QqqvkTFtzYyWEf
transaction
15ea1d5e75c4e54c73ac863dad295161fad2c1102d0d4f6aa19cb1c5ce862579
spent
true